> We are migrating and updating scads of accumulated FrameMaker documents
> into Confluence, using the old FrameMaker version 7.2 (with MIf2Go as a
> converter).  Yes, I know this is an old version, but it works.
>
> My old PC is being decommissioned and I'm reinstalling FrameMaker 7.2 on a
> new Windows 10 machine.  When I visit the FrameMaker patch web page at
> https://supportdownloads.adobe.com/product.jsp?product=22&platform=Windows
> I see two patches applicable for FrameMaker 7.2 that I want to install.  My
> problem is I forget just how I am supposed to handle the downloaded
> patches' Zip folders.  When I unzip it one in place within the Downloads
> folder and click its contained setup.exe program, a wizard starts but gives
> me an ominous "Severe" error popup (not elaborating what is so severe),
> followed by an off-the-wall message that "The system is running very low on
> disk. You need to free up at least 40 MB of space" when in fact my hard
> drive has plenty of space.
>
> Alternatively, I also tried clicking Help > Updates from within the
> FrameMaker program itself, but this produces a pop up "Uploading Adobe
> Online Components" highlighting "AWEXFiles.txt" followed by a message that
> reads "There was a problem connecting to Adobe Online" and "Adobe Online
> Error;File Could Not Be Downloaded."
>
> Am I doing something wrong?  Any tips from you FrameMaker mavens would be
> appreciated. Maybe it's an Adobe end-of-life statement for version 7.2.
